Looking for any information on Scanlon's (Scanlan/Scanlin)who are buried in Old St Ambrose Catholic cemetery in Des Moines Iowa. I don't have dates, but I do have information that states there is a lot assigned to a SCANLON family, marked by a stone bearing the names of JOHN, JAMES, and THOMAS SCANLON, the stone may have dates but that wasn't passed on to me. Also buried in that lot is a John Doud b.1826 (Ireland) d. 1871 in Dallas County Iowa, and his wife MARY SCANLON Doud b. 1824 Ireland d. 1897 Des Moines. I am trying to find the relationship between Mary and the Scanlon's buried there. Any information on any Scanlon's in Des Moines or even Dallas County Iowa, especially the James John or Thomas SCANLON families would be greatly appreciated. Thanks, Kay
